Faceless
The term "faceless" typically refers to something or someone that lacks a visible or identifiable face. This can be taken literally, as in the case of a faceless mannequin or a faceless character in a story. However, it can also be used metaphorically to describe something that is anonymous or lacking in individuality. A faceless entity can evoke a sense of anonymity, making it difficult to discern its intentions or motivations. This can create a sense of unease or mystery, as the lack of a face makes it harder to connect with or understand the entity in question.
Unknown
In contrast, the term "unknown" refers to something that is not familiar or recognized. It can refer to a person, place, or thing that is not known or understood. The unknown can be a source of fear or curiosity, as it represents a realm of uncertainty and unpredictability. When something is unknown, it can be difficult to anticipate its actions or outcomes, leading to feelings of apprehension or excitement. The unknown can be both thrilling and terrifying, as it holds the potential for discovery or danger.
